Transaction 8601c4abb89b278e7a2d85b9aa4aa8244dc30a9080851341599d00f5965a4a06
1 Input
1 Output
-
8601c4abb89b278e7a2d85b9aa4aa8244dc30a9080851341599d00f5965a4a06:0
- value
- 13654172
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5577ec6a8b47e2cb97b4842fe1584dc9df71acd OP_EQUAL
- address
- 3M94fgH5vntTe9Efyh4FXM9y6WAwN8ccZH